Apple released new Quad Core MacPros

Ahead of next week's MacExpo in SanFran Apple have updated their MacPros with new Quad Core CPUs. Each machine can take 2 processors (so that's 8 cores), 4 hard disks (SATA or SAS), 1 or 2 16x SuperDrives, an Airport (WiFi 802.11n) and a SAS RAID controller.

The stock video card is an NVIDIA 8800, but this can be downgraded to an ATI card. However the system can now hold 4 of the ATI cards allowing a MacPro to drive 4 cinema displays simultaneously. The top of the range card is an NVidia FX4600.
